Abstract

The article adopts the soil weight method to propose an optimized calculation method for the buried depth of the ground anchor of carrying rope of material ropeway of transmission line, considering the shallow burial and deep burial situations. In the case of different soil types and conditions, the angle between the carrying rope and the horizontal ground, etc., a calculation process was designed to determine the minimum buried depth of ground anchor that meets the requirements of anti-pulling stability. The calculation result meets the construction safety requirements of ground anchor burying, and provides a calculation basis for the construction of ground anchor burying of carrying rope of material ropeway of transmission line.
